Driver Hire Bradford is seeking an experienced HGV Class 1 Bulk Tipper Driver for a temp-to-perm position in Bradford. This role involves operating HGV Class 1 vehicles for a dynamic recycling and waste management organization.
Ideal candidates will have a valid HGV Class 1 licence and awareness of health and safety. The company offers competitive pay, full training, and immediate starts for qualified drivers.

How to prepare for a job interview at Driver Hire Bradford
✨Know Your Stuff
Make sure you’re familiar with the specifics of HGV Class 1 vehicles and the bulk tipper operations. Brush up on your knowledge of health and safety regulations, as this will show that you take the role seriously and understand the importance of safety in the recycling and waste management sector.
✨Dress for Success
Even though you’re applying for a driving position, first impressions matter! Dress smartly and professionally for your interview. It shows respect for the company and indicates that you’re serious about the opportunity.
✨Prepare for Practical Questions
Expect questions that assess your driving experience and problem-solving skills on the road. Think about scenarios you’ve faced while driving and how you handled them. This will help you demonstrate your expertise and readiness for the job.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the training process, team dynamics, or what a typical day looks like. This shows your enthusiasm for the role and hel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
